Buying Guide for Landscape Edging with River Rock
When selecting landscape edging for river rock, several factors are important to consider for both aesthetics and function:
- Material durability: Choose edging materials resistant to weather, moisture, and UV exposure. Durable plastic, galvanized steel, or composite materials often provide longevity.
- Flexibility: Flexible edging easily adapts to natural curves and irregular shapes typical of river rock landscapes.
- Height and containment: Edging height should be sufficient to keep rocks contained without being obtrusive. Taller edging better secures larger stones.
- Installation method: No-dig or pound-in designs simplify installation and reduce soil disturbance. Consider your comfort level with DIY projects.
- Anchoring system: Proper stakes or spikes keep edging secure in soft or uneven ground, especially for curved layouts.
- Environmental compatibility: Edging styles that blend with natural stone or garden themes enhance visual appeal.
- Maintenance: Select edging that requires minimal upkeep and resists fading, cracking, or rusting.
